There are many different kinds of exercise balls.  They come in different colors, sizes and weights.   The three most popular and effective exercise balls are the stability ball, Medicine ball, and BOSU ball.


Stability Balls:  The Best Exercise Ball ?best exercise ball duraball

Stability balls are also known as Swiss balls or physio balls.  Some people may be referring to stability balls when they ask about exercise balls.  Stability balls are rubbery inflatable balls of various sizes and colors.

They can be used to a variety of exercises for your whole body.  The only muscle group which you cannot exercise solely with a stability ball is your upper body pulling muscle group (back and biceps.)

Stability balls are best used for stabilization, strength and balance exercises.  Stability balls are a good alternative to an office chair.  When you use a stability ball as an office chair, you could lower the chances of lower back pain and improve your posture.

You can also use stability balls in place of weight benches.  If you are performing any chest or shoulder pressing exercises, you can form the supine bridge position.  This makes a stable position where you can perform presses while keeping your core and legs exercising.

Since stability balls come in different sizes and strengths it is important to know how to choose the right size stability ball for you.

 

How to Choose a Stability Ball that Fits You

First of all, every stability ball is not created equally.  The old saying "You get what you pay for," is a good philosophy to use when buying a stability ball.  Stability balls that pump up very firm are the best exercise ball compared to balls that pump up flimsy.  The flimsy exercise balls can be better for some exercises where the firm balls cannot.

Even though different exercises may be better if you use a different sized stability ball, you have a size which is best for you.  Stability balls usually come in sizes of 45, 50, 55, 60 up to 80 centimeters.  If the packaging says a certain size is for a certain height, do not go by that.  If you have short or long legs, this measuring tool will not work correctly.

You can find which size of stability ball is right for you by sitting on a properly inflated stability ball.  If your legs in front of you form a 90 degree angle with your heels directly below your knees the ball is just about the right size.

best exercise ball medicineMedicine Balls

Medicine balls weight from 2-30+ pounds.  They are usually made up of dense rubber, or leather stuffed with sand or some other heavy material.  Some have laces and some do not.  The bigger they get, the heavier they get.

Medicine balls stake their claim as one of the best exercise balls because they are tremendous for power development.  Explosive training is the medicine balls best use, although it is very versatile.

The medicine ball can also be used simply as a weight.  Instead of holding a couple dumbbells, you can hold a medicine ball for certain movements.  In some cases, holding a medicine ball is more ergonomic than holding another form of resistance.  They are also good for uses similar to stability balls.

Some medicine balls bounce and others do not.  You should know which kind you want before you buy a set.  Bouncing medicine balls are better for exercises where you need to roll or bounce the ball.  Medicine balls that do not bounce are better for catching because they are easier to grip.

BOSU Balls

The dome shaped BOSU which is an acronym for Both Sides UP is really the BOSU balance trainer.

It was invented in 1999 by a guy named David Weck and has been heavily used in gyms across the world since then. 

The BOSU can be used for a lot of the same exercises as stability balls.  It is far more versatile than stability balls because it can be used for low level, beginner exercises as well as advance stabilization, strength and explosive power exercises.

The flat surface on the BOSU can be used for most of the same uses of the round side.  In different exercises the difficulty will be increased or decreased by using the opposite side.
